WebOct 26, 2024 · Around two-thirds of Russia is covered by permafrost -- permanently frozen ground that never thaws, even during summers. It runs from just below the surface of much of Siberia for sometimes thousands of meters underground, kept frozen by the region's fierce colds. But Siberia is warming and faster than almost anywhere else on Earth. WebJul 3, 2014 · But Russia's title to all of the land is only about 150 years old. WebApr 5, 2024 · In Russia, however, although some land has gone out of cultivation in the taiga forest and northern mixed forest zone, a much larger proportion of the cultivated land is poor and marginal, which reduces average yields. The most remarkable feature of Russian agriculture determined by climate was the great fluctuations in yields. These were much ...
